The Logan Subdivision is a railroad line owned by CSX Transportation in the U.S. state of West Virginia. It was formerly part of the CSX Huntington East Division.[1] It became part of the CSX Florence Division on June 20, 2016. The line runs from Barboursville, West Virginia, to Gilbert, West Virginia, for a total of 87.2 miles. At its north end the line continues south from the Kanawha Subdivision and at its south end the line connects with Norfolk Southern.[2]
